如何从 Ignite 缓存中获取更新的值?

How to fetch Updated values from Ignite Cache?

我有一个 ignite 缓存,数据不断地插入其中。有什么方法可以只从缓存中获取更新的值吗?我需要将这些数据不重复地插入到 Hive 中。

Ignite 基本上有三种策略来处理它:连续查询、缓存存储和Cache Events

根据您的描述,Continuous Query 似乎最适合您,但是请注意,初始查询和处理程序的第一次回调之间可能会有微小的重叠。

否则,如果您想让 Ignite 始终与 Hive 同步,Cache Store 和 Write Through 是您最好的朋友。